Cannabis topping is a pruning technique that involves strategically cutting off the top part of the main stem or the dominant shoot of a cannabis plant. The primary objective is to encourage the plant to divert its energy and resources towards the growth of multiple branches and secondary shoots. This action results in a bushier and more productive plant overall.

Fimming, an abbreviation for “F**k, I Missed,” is a pruning technique that takes a less aggressive approach compared to cannabis fimming. With fimming weed palnts, you’ll be pinching off the top growth of the main stem or dominant shoot, but you’ll leave a small portion behind. This subtle modification encourages the development of multiple shoot tips and contributes to a bushier growth pattern.

In cannabis cultivation, the decision between cannabis topping vs. fimming should align with your specific needs and circumstances. Topping encourages lateral growth and is well-suited for maximizing yields in spacious grow areas. In contrast, fimming is a more forgiving method that thrives in compact spaces. Always remember to consider your strain’s characteristics and your level of experience when determining which technique to employ.
1. Is topping or fimming better for increasing yields?
Both cannabis topping and fimming can enhance yields, but topping is often favored for achieving larger yields in more spacious grow environments.
2. Can I use both topping and fimming on the same plant?
Yes, some growers employ a combination of both techniques to strike a balance between a bushy structure and increased bud sites.
3. How long does it take for a plant to recover after topping or fimming?
Recovery times can vary but generally range from a few days to a couple of weeks. Keep a close eye on your plants during this critical period.
4. Are there strains that don’t respond well to topping or fimming?
Yes, some strains may not exhibit favorable responses to these techniques, so researching your strain’s specific traits beforehand is advisable.
5. Can I use these techniques in outdoor cultivation?
Absolutely, both cannabis topping and fimming can be applied to outdoor cannabis plants to enhance growth and yield, provided you consider the unique conditions of outdoor cultivation.
